work hard work smart

专注于Java后端开发。 不断总结,举一反三。
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理
上一页 1 ··· 7 8 9 10 11 12 13 14 15 ··· 58 下一页

2020年6月10日

摘要: 随着访问量的增加,nginx的日志会越来越多,日志体积会越来越大,不便于运维人员查看。切割可以以天为单位,如果日志每天有几百个G或者几个T的话。则可以按需每半天或者每小时对日志切割。 1、nginx日志切割shell /usr/local/nginx/sbin vi cut_my_log.sh #! 阅读全文

posted @ 2020-06-10 23:30 work hard work smart 阅读(175) 评论(0) 推荐(0) 编辑

摘要: 1、MySQL登录 mysql -u root password '123456' //登录 mysql -u root -p 设置密码 2、MySQL启动 使用mysqld方式启动 cd /opt/mysql-5.7.24-el7-x86_64/bin ./mysqld --defaults-fi 阅读全文

posted @ 2020-06-10 17:22 work hard work smart 阅读(156) 评论(0) 推荐(0) 编辑

2020年6月9日

摘要: 1 、什么是Nginx Nginx(engine x)是一个高性能HTTP和反向代理web服务器,同时也提供IMAP/POP3/SMTP服务 --来自百度百科 主要功能反向代理 通过配置文件可以实现集群和负载均衡 静态资源虚拟化 2、常见的服务器 MS IIS asp.net Weblogic、Jb 阅读全文

posted @ 2020-06-09 11:15 work hard work smart 阅读(155) 评论(0) 推荐(0) 编辑

2020年6月8日

摘要: Dubbo基本概念 1、URL 统一资源定位器 标准的URL格式 protocol://username:password@host:port/path?key=value&key2=value2 Dubbo中的URL 在Dubbo中: 服务是资源, dubbo://192.168.1.1:2088 阅读全文

posted @ 2020-06-08 15:03 work hard work smart 阅读(126) 评论(0) 推荐(0) 编辑

2020年6月1日

摘要: 工具下载地址: https://github.com/HelloKittyNII/ZooViewer 下载后解压ZooViewer.zip 解压后的目录结构 运行startup.bat 输入连接的IP和端口 连接后的客户端界面如下图所示 阅读全文

posted @ 2020-06-01 18:12 work hard work smart 阅读(1603) 评论(0) 推荐(0) 编辑

摘要: 一、准备 1、启动zookeeper 2、启动kafka 3、kafka创建主题。主题名称为:couponTopic ./k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 阅读全文

posted @ 2020-06-01 14:46 work hard work smart 阅读(763) 评论(0) 推荐(0) 编辑

2020年5月31日

摘要: Spring Boot版本v1.5.19.RELEASE 1、增加Jar <dependency> <groupId>com.spring4all</groupId> <artifactId>spring-boot-starter-hbase</artifactId> <version>1.0.0. 阅读全文

posted @ 2020-05-31 15:12 work hard work smart 阅读(1077) 评论(0) 推荐(0) 编辑

2020年5月30日

摘要: HBase是一个分布式的数据库 主要作用: 海量数据的存储和海量数据的准实时查询 1、HBase安装说明 JDK1.7以上(JDK安装这里不作介绍) Hadoop-2.5.0以上。 我这里用的是Hadoop2.6 Zookeeper-3.4.* 以上。 我这里是Zookeeper-3.4.13 参考 阅读全文

posted @ 2020-05-30 15:19 work hard work smart 阅读(258) 评论(0) 推荐(0) 编辑

2020年5月27日

摘要: 1、下载Jenkins https://www.jenkins.io/zh/download/ 2、将war部署到tomcat下 3、创建用户并登陆 4、Jenkins全局工具配置 1) 进入Manage Jenkins 2) 进入Global Tool Configuration 3) 配置Mav 阅读全文

posted @ 2020-05-27 17:06 work hard work smart 阅读(389) 评论(0) 推荐(0) 编辑

2020年5月22日

摘要: 1、上传镜像到公有仓库 hub.docker.com 1)、登录https://hub.docker.com/ 创建账号 2)、docker images 找一个小一点的images,如hello-world 3)、打上tag docker tag hello-world:latest larry0 阅读全文

posted @ 2020-05-22 13:32 work hard work smart 阅读(308) 评论(0) 推荐(0) 编辑

2020年5月21日

摘要: 1、下载jre https://hub.docker.com/_/openjdk?tab=tags 我这里使用的是openjkd版本为8u102-jre docker pull openjdk:8u102-jre 2、运行jre docker run -it --entrypoint bash op 阅读全文

posted @ 2020-05-21 12:29 work hard work smart 阅读(222) 评论(0) 推荐(0) 编辑

2020年5月20日

摘要: 一、创建工程mircosevice 整体工程结构 这里主要介绍EdgeServcie服务通过Thrift调用用户服务 Thrift在Window下安装可参考: Window下 分布式框架 thrift的安装 二、创建用户接口定义模块 1、创建用户接口定义模块 user-thrift-service- 阅读全文

posted @ 2020-05-20 10:48 work hard work smart 阅读(752) 评论(0) 推荐(0) 编辑

2020年5月19日

摘要: 一、Thrift介绍 Thrift最初由Facebook开发,后来提交给了Apache基金会将Thrift作为一个开源项目。facebook开发使用为了解决系统中各个系统间大数据量的传输通信以及系统之间语言环境不同需要夸平台特性,支持C++,Java,Python,PHP, Ruby,Erlang, 阅读全文

posted @ 2020-05-19 15:53 work hard work smart 阅读(323) 评论(0) 推荐(0) 编辑

2020年5月11日

摘要: 一、概念 分布式事务就是将多个节点的事务看成一个整体处理 分布式事务由事务参与者、资源服务器、事务管理器等组成 常见的分布式事务的例子: 支付、下订单等 二、实现思路 两段式事务和三段式事务 基于XA的分布式事务 基于消息的最终一致性方案 TCC编程式补偿事务(被认为最好的方式) 1、两段式事务(很 阅读全文

posted @ 2020-05-11 22:42 work hard work smart 阅读(227) 评论(0) 推荐(0) 编辑

2020年5月10日

摘要: Dubbo特性之结果缓存,并发、连接控制 一、结果缓存 Dubbo可以通过注解对热点数据进行缓存 Dubbo结果缓存是本地缓存,Redis是分布式缓存 二、并发、连接控制 Dubbo可以对连接和并发数量进行控制,超出部分以错误形式返回 1) 连接控制: Dubbo是一个长连接,可以控制连接的数量 a 阅读全文

posted @ 2020-05-10 16:42 work hard work smart 阅读(345) 评论(0) 推荐(0) 编辑

2020年5月7日

摘要: 1、启动检查 服务启动过程中验证服务提供者的可用性 验证过程出现问题,则阻止整个Spring容器初始化 服务启动检查可以尽可能早的发现服务问题 某些场景下,如服务A调用服务B,服务B调用服务A,这样两个服务永远启动不了 解决方法: 关闭启动检查 2、负载均衡 如A服务调用B服务,B服务有四个(部署在 阅读全文

posted @ 2020-05-07 23:24 work hard work smart 阅读(197) 评论(0) 推荐(0) 编辑

摘要: 项目介绍: 用户服务: 服务提供方,提供了如登录方法。 网关服务: 提供Rest接口,如授权接口,然后在通过Dubbo调用用户服务的登录方法。 1、项目结构如下如 guns-api: 公共接口 guns-gateway: 网关服务 (从guns-rest复制过来,依赖于guns-api) guns- 阅读全文

posted @ 2020-05-07 14:26 work hard work smart 阅读(535) 评论(0) 推荐(0) 编辑

摘要: 1、Dubbo架构图 角色说明: 阅读全文

posted @ 2020-05-07 14:10 work hard work smart 阅读(134) 评论(0) 推荐(0) 编辑

摘要: 1、很早以前,部署/发布应用程序的方式 一台物理机,安装操作系统,然后安装应用程序 缺点: 部署非常慢 成本非常高 资源浪费 难于迁移和扩展 可能会被限定硬件厂商 2、虚拟化技术 为了解决上面的问题,出现了虚拟化技术 特点: 一个物理机可以部署多个app 每个app独立运行在一个VM里 虚拟化的优点 阅读全文

posted @ 2020-05-07 11:23 work hard work smart 阅读(565) 评论(0) 推荐(0) 编辑

2020年5月6日

摘要: 开发工具Idea 一、无注册中心,消费者直接调用提供者 1、工程结构如下: dubboapi: 接口定义 provider: 服务提供者,依赖于dubboapi consumer: 服务消费者,依赖于dubboapi SpringBoot版本为2.2.6 2、创建dubboapi模块 里面定义了一个 阅读全文

posted @ 2020-05-06 16:17 work hard work smart 阅读(482) 评论(0) 推荐(0) 编辑

上一页 1 ··· 7 8 9 10 11 12 13 14 15 ··· 58 下一页